2. What ActAcross is (and is not)

ActAcross is a web application that helps actors rehearse scripted scenes with an AI scene partner on their computer.

The app is a rehearsal aid only. It does not provide professional coaching, casting decisions, employment advice, or legal advice.

ActAcross does not record, store, or export audition videos. If you film a self-tape, you do so separately on your own device (for example, a phone). The computer is intended to sit beside that device and display the scene partner.

5. Plans, billing, and fair use

Referral offers, when available, are governed by the Referral program section below, including eligibility, payment confirmation, reward timing, and restrictions. Accepting those terms is required to claim an introductory referral offer.

ActAcross offers a free tier and paid subscriptions billed through our payment provider. Paid plans renew monthly until canceled; cancellation takes effect at the end of the current billing period.

Where plan features are described as "unlimited," this refers to your rehearsal activity: unlimited scenes, rehearsal sessions, and replays of previously generated partner audio. Generating new AI partner audio is computationally expensive and is subject to the fair-use limits below.

Fair use: if the volume of newly generated partner audio on an account in a calendar month substantially exceeds typical individual rehearsal use, new generations may be served with a lighter voice model and simplified delivery for the remainder of that month. Above a higher abuse threshold, new voice generation may be paused until the monthly window resets. Previously generated audio continues to play normally, and no scenes, notes, or other data are removed or lost.

These thresholds exist to prevent abuse and keep the service sustainable for everyone. They are set well above what an individual actor reaches through normal rehearsal, including heavy daily use. We may adjust the thresholds over time and will reflect material changes on this page. Accounts engaged in automated, scripted, shared, or resale use of voice generation may be suspended.
